Beginner Level
What Is It?
Leverage is the use of borrowed money — or instruments that behave like borrowed money — to amplify exposure to an investment. A position with 2x leverage moves twice as much as the underlying for every unit of price change, in both directions.
Origin
Leverage is as old as credit itself, but modern leveraged investing emerged with margin lending in the 1920s, futures markets in the 1970s, and prime brokerage in the 1980s. The 2008 crisis exposed the systemic dangers of hidden leverage in shadow banking and structured products.
Why It Matters
Leverage is the primary driver of how losses become catastrophic. It converts manageable drawdowns into forced liquidations and turns liquidity stress into solvency events. Understanding leverage — operating, financial, and embedded — is the single most important skill in risk management.
Intermediate Level
Market Mechanics
Leverage takes many forms: margin loans, securities financing, repo, total-return swaps, futures, options, and structured notes. It is measured by ratios (debt-to-equity, gross/net exposure, notional-to-NAV) and by sensitivity (delta, beta, value-at-risk per dollar of capital). Hidden leverage hides in derivatives, off-balance-sheet entities, and rehypothecation chains.
How It Behaves
Leverage compresses time. A 30 percent drawdown at 1x leverage may take months to develop; at 5x leverage it can produce a margin call in hours. Cross-asset deleveraging is the mechanism that turns local shocks (March 2020, September 2022 LDI, Archegos) into global liquidity events.
Key Data to Watch
- Margin debt (FINRA, Fed Z.1)
- Prime-broker financing rates and haircuts
- Futures open interest and commercial vs. speculative positioning
- Repo volumes and rates
- Hedge-fund gross and net exposure surveys
Advanced Level
Institutional Behavior
Hedge funds, banks, and family offices use leverage to express conviction, fund relative-value strategies, and meet return targets. Risk management focuses on stress testing leverage under correlation breakdowns, gap moves, and funding shocks. Concentration risk plus leverage is the signature of every major blow-up (LTCM, Bear Stearns, Lehman, Archegos).
Professional Use Cases
- Relative-value strategies that monetize basis with high leverage
- Capital-efficient portfolio construction via futures and swaps
- Carry trades funded in low-yield currencies
- Risk-parity overlays that lever bonds to match equity volatility

Key Takeaways
Leverage doesn't change expected return, but it changes the distribution of outcomes — fattening tails and shortening time-to-ruin. The right amount of leverage is set by survival under stress, not by maximizing returns under base case.
